Trump Voices Growing Doubts Over Russia–Ukraine Peace Efforts

admin8 months ago8 months ago03 mins

President Donald Trump has become increasingly pessimistic about the likelihood of ending the war in Ukraine anytime soon. According to individuals familiar with his thinking, Trump has expressed doubt that Russian President Vladimir Putin and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y will meet for direct negotiations in the near future.

ICE Policy Requires In-Person Interviews for Parents Reuniting with Children

admin8 months ago8 months ago03 mins

A recent policy update, issued via a July 9 memo from the Office of Refugee Resettlement (ORR), now mandates that parents or guardians seeking to reunite with children who entered the United States unaccompanied must participate in in-person interviews for identity and eligibility verification.
